Electricity will be cleaner and cheaper
On the island of Graciosa, Portugal, its 4500 inhabitants are powered primarily from solar and wind power. The battery here is used for network stability, as well as accommodating the excess energy production. There is also a diesel generator engine, but more often it is not used. So the cost of electricity production goes down.
Salt water as heat storage
The power station in Morocco uses salt to store heat. During the day, electricity from solar energy is used to heat the tubes of salt water. At night, salt solution can produce heat, which is used to generate electricity.
Energy from the water tank
Hot storage tubes are also frequently used, such as in the Deutsche Welle building. With collectors mounted on the roof of the building, solar heat is channeled into the tank to heat the water. The hot water can be used for kitchens and bathrooms. For long-lasting heat, the tank is well insulated. In the tube there is also an electrically operated heater, in case of insufficient solar energy.
Lamps with solar electricity
About 1.5 billion people in the world live without access to electricity grids, especially in Asia and Africa. Energy-efficient LED lighting technology opens new breakthroughs, for example in Senegal: These lights use solar energy and are enough to function throughout the night. Because the price of its components dropped dramatically, solar and LED technology is also getting cheaper and affordable.
Battery technology is increasingly in demand
This battery technology is on the verge of a global boom. Especially in China, Korea and the US built large factories for the production of Lithium-Ion batteries. Battery and battery prices have also dropped dramatically. Batteries are mainly used in transportation and as local electrical suppliers.
Prices sag
During this time, the price of electric cars is very expensive because the battery technology was still expensive. But compared to 10 years ago, the price of the battery has dropped dramatically to live 10 to 20 percent price first. If first the price of batteries for electric cars with a range of 150 km about 20,000 Euros, now costs 2,500 to 3,000 Euros
